French Exchange Students Depart

Thirteen students from Oswestry School are setting off today on a 7-day French exchange visit, accompanied by Mrs Chidlow and Mr Jensen. They are travelling to the Lycée St Jean at Besançon in north east France. The students, who are studying French at GCSE or A level, will be staying with French families or the Lycée’s boarding houses.

“We are all looking forward to our visit,” said Mrs Chidlow. “As well as taking part in lessons at the Lycée, we have visits to Dijon and Beaune; we shall also be going to ‘Musiques des Rues’, which is a popular live music festival in Besançon.”

This is the second leg of the French exchange. In March 2008 a group of students from the Lycée St Jean visited Oswestry for 9 days.
